Is Perfection Your Right?

Sometimes we can get so caught up in doing things ‘right’ that our hope for perfection turns into a form of legalism and we discover grace has been abandoned.

We try to hold others to a form of perfection that we ourselves are striving for or think we need to attain.

We cannot attain it and neither can they… and it frustrates and angers us.

What do we need to let go of so grace can come to the rescue?
